Output 52fcf9992f1d3998c64db2c7eb17b19b756e86661fb243fb97c29369bf181e80:164

value
1673556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d75cd1cf34954f9ae55875476ad0027c0987ad6 OP_EQUAL
address
DRL4zdECDX4YdjdokL5TVKxqEyhneJhpiW
transaction
52fcf9992f1d3998c64db2c7eb17b19b756e86661fb243fb97c29369bf181e80
spent
true